Thanos and his children – Corvus Glaive, Proxima Midnight, Ebony Maw and Cull Obsidian – destroy planet Xandar to retrieve the Power Stone and begin assembling the Infinity Gauntlet.
Meanwhile, on Earth, The Avengers are disbanded. Captain America, Black Widow and Falcon are wanted vigilantes, Scarlet Witch and Vision are on a romantic getaway in Scotland, Hawkeye and Ant-Man went off the grid, and Iron Man is developing new technologies to protect Earth from another alien invasion.
Thanos attacks the Asgardians’ ship and defeats Thor, who is cast out into space. Loki uses the Space Stone to teleport Bruce Banner to the Sanctum Sanctorum in New York City to find help and then surrenders it to Thanos in exchange for the Asgardians’ lives, becoming Thanos’ advisor. Thor is later found by the Guardians of the Galaxy, who are investigating Xandar’s destruction.
Rocket and Groot accompany Thor to the kingdom of Dwarf King Eitri, who forged the Infinity Gauntlet for Thanos, and then had his hands cut off Eitri’s hands so as to not interfere with Thanos’ plans. Thor builds a new weapon, the Stormbreaker, which can damage the Infinity Gauntlet.
Meanwhile, Banner is found by Doctor Strange, who contacts Iron Man. Upon learning of the impending invasion, Iron Man begrudgingly asks Captain America for help. Spider-Man joins Iron Man and Doctor Strange as they battle Ebony Maw and Cull Obsidian, who steal the Time Stone from Strange. The trio pursues them to Thanos’ warship, which leaves Earth.
Meanwhile, Scarlet Witch and Vision are ambushed in Scotland by Corvus Glaive and Proxima Midnight, but rescued by Captain America, who takes them to Wakanda so Black Panther and his forces can protect the Vision. Black Panther's sister Shuri extracts the Mind Gem from Vision's forehead.
